i have given HSC this year. if i wanna become a mobile app developer then what should i do? where should i take admission?

Hi, Streams after 12th to enroll in are:

  • Bachelor of Engineering (B.E or B. Tech)- Information Technology (IT)
  • BCA
  • BSC IT

You can also enroll for a degree in computer science, software engineering, or another programming related field and specialize in mobile application coding.

Very importantly, as a mobile app developer, you will be working in at least one of the five major platforms  Android, iOS, Windows, Symbian, or RIM (Blackberry). While you can and should be able to code in all these platforms, you will have to choose one to specialize in when you are just starting out.
BUT this is for later stage.
